Focused on digestive health, this podcast addresses various aspects of gut well-being, particularly for individuals experiencing conditions like IBS and SIBO. The discussions cover comprehensive topics including dietary strategies, the role of gut health in overall wellness, and approaches to manage symptoms through nutrition, lifestyle modifications, and supplementation. Episodes often feature expert insights and personal stories that emphasize the importance of individualized care in treating gut-related ailments. Notably, the podcast aims to combine evidence-based advice with relatable experiences to improve listeners' understanding and management of their digestive health.
